Reports generated on the Ashvale cluster intermittently return rows in a different order than on staging. Root cause is configuration drift: two production nodes still run the legacy comparator flag, so ties are broken by insertion order instead of row ID. Customers noticed because exported spreadsheets differ run-to-run. Proposal for the sync: enforce the stable-sort flag fleet-wide through the config manager and add a drift alert. For discussion, the intended baseline configuration is:

service settings:
[casax]
port = 6379
team = rusir
host = casax.zemvarhq.corp
region = outer-4
access_code = ac_9808ce
timeout_ms = 1500

09:41 — The waveform preview service in Songlark began returning blank renders for uploads longer than twenty minutes. Investigation showed the Reedmoor transcoder was emitting truncated peak files after yesterday's memory-limit change, and the preview renderer silently treated the short files as valid. We restored the previous memory ceiling at 10:07, confirmed correct previews on three long-form test tracks, and queued a backfill for roughly 1,400 affected uploads. The regression was introduced in the build identified directly below.

build token for tawip-yageg: htk9_92ac43d42

## Capacity Note: DNS Resolution Flakiness in the Plugin Runtime

Plugin authors: the Thornby runtime occasionally sees slow or failed DNS lookups under burst load, which surfaces as intermittent connection timeouts in plugin HTTP calls. We now pre-warm the resolver cache and cap concurrent lookups per sandbox. If your plugin makes outbound calls, size your retry logic against these limits rather than hardcoding your own. The effective resolver constants are shown below.

tuning constants:
QUOTAS = {
    "druwyn": 5,
    "holix": 5,
    "zorath": 5,
    "holwyn": 10,
}

MEMO — Exam Logistics, Harwick Testing Board

Sealed exam papers for the Velmora District sitting leave the Arkfield print facility Thursday, 05:30. One pallet, tamper-banded, manifest attached. Driver does not break seals under any circumstances. No stops between Arkfield and the Velmora depot. Coordinator confirms arrival by radio, not phone. Seal numbers must match the manifest before sign-off. The confidential hand-over instruction for the courier follows below.

drop instructions, yafog-yawip: the quenmir olidor courier leaves the julox tamion keliel ledger at gate 5283 under passcode 336825